Subject: Handover — Kioskline watchdog

Hi Darven,

Before I rotate off, here's the state of the Kioskline kiosk app watchdog. It pings each terminal every 30 seconds and restarts the UI process after three missed heartbeats. Restart events are logged to the ops schema; the release manager wants those counts in the weekly report. The nightly purge job trims entries older than 90 days. The watchdog writes to the ops database using this connection string.

replica DSN, tawef-hahap: mysql://eliix_svc:FiIC0jz@db-394a.lumiclabs.internal:5432/holius

## Configuration

Sketchloom's undo and redo stack is configurable per workspace. By default the editor keeps 200 steps in memory; support can raise this for customers with large diagrams, though memory use grows roughly linearly. Set SKETCHLOOM_UNDO_DEPTH in the env file to override it. Redo history is cleared on save unless SKETCHLOOM_PERSIST_REDO is true. All history is encrypted at rest when sync is enabled, which requires a signing secret in the same env file. That secret belongs on the very next line.

env line for tawig-kadup: VAULT_KEY5=07c4f

Handover note — from Marla to Deniz. New starters will sometimes ask about the basement archive at Corvane House. It holds finance files from 2015 onward plus the old Lintwell project boxes. The room is at the bottom of stairwell B, second door on the left past the boiler room. Lights are on a timer; the switch is outside the door. Sign the clipboard on entry and exit. The door uses the shared keypad, and the current code is below.

door code, yagap-bahof: bdg-O-05